The children are like pliable "Clay"
They say that children learn from their environment.

If a child lives in an environment of criticism, he learns to condemn.
If a child lives with hostility, he learns to fight.
If the child is surrounded by ridicule, he becomes timid.
If the child is a shame, he learns to be guilty.
If a child lives in an atmosphere of encouragement, then he becomes confident.
If the child is praised, he learns to be grateful.
If the child is honest, he learns to be fair.
If a child is brought up in security, he learns to trust.
If a child grows up in an atmosphere of approval, then it increases self-esteem.
If a child lives with the atmosphere of goodwill, he can find
and love in their lives.
